Technical Validation for Commercial Production

Before committing this digital product to a commercial workflow, rigorous technical testing is non-negotiable. This is a DIGITAL PRODUCT File for cutting machines. Make sure that you have the appropriate software to work with these file formats. The package includes file formats CDR, EPS, SVG, PNG This multi-layer desig structure requires careful inspection. I recommend the following validation steps for any designer or crafter:

  1. Vector Integrity Check: Open the SVG and EPS files in Adobe Illustrator or CorelDRAW to ensure all paths are closed and layers are logically organized. Multi-layer designs can sometimes have overlapping cut lines that waste material.
  2. Contrast Testing: Preview the PNG design in black and white to verify that the depth is readable without color reliance. This ensures the design works on monochrome cutting machines or for sublimation design on dark fabrics.
  3. Typography Pairing: Test the asset alongside various typefaces. I found it pairs best with hand-lettered script fonts or rugged slab serifs. Avoid delicate thin sans-serifs, as they lack the visual weight to balance the bold pirate aesthetic.
  4. Material Simulation: Always perform a test cut on your intended paper weight. 3D SVG structures rely on precise scoring and folding; cardstock that is too thick will crack, while paper that is too thin will not hold the shape.
  5. Licensing Verification: Confirm the commercial license terms specifically regarding physical sales versus digital redistribution. Protecting your business means understanding exactly how you are permitted to monetize the asset.
